FIELD: methods and devices for metal processing.
SUBSTANCE: invention relates to a method of laser welding of one or several steel sheets made from boron-containing manganese steel hardened under pressure, wherein at least one and steel sheets (1, 2; 2') have coating (4) made of aluminium. Laser welding is performed with supply of additional wire (11) to welding bath (9) formed by means of laser beam (6). Additional wire (11) contains at least one alloying element influencing stabilization of austenite. Laser beam (6) is adjusted so that it oscillates across welding direction with frequency of at least 200 Hz.
EFFECT: technical result is that at relatively low power consumption provides strength of weld after hot forming (hardening under press), comparable with strength of base material, wherein removal of aluminium coating can be excluded on edges of sheets to be welded.
